Coast Guard searching for overdue sailor on voyage from Hilo to Canada

The U.S. Coast Guard is searching for a Canadian sailor who was seen leaving Hilo last month for Victoria, British Columbia, Canada, but hasn’t arrived.

Paul Lim, of British Colombia, reportedly left Hilo on Aug. 1 aboard the 35-foot sailing vessel Watercolour.

The Coast Guard estimated Lim should have arrived in Victoria by Sept. 11.

On Wednesday, the Coast Guard at Rescue Coordination Center Alameda began asking mariners along Lim’s possible route to be on the lookout for his boat. Dozens of commercial vessels and all mariners along the Pacific coast were alerted.

A C-130 plane from Air Station Barbers Point searched in an area between Hilo and Victoria on Thursday with no sign of Lim.

The Canadian Coast Guard has contacted Lim’s family, who reported him overdue.

The Watercolour is a 35-foot white hulled vessel with white sails and a blue canvas dodger. Lim was also towing a 9-foot dingy behind the Watercolour.

Anyone with information on the whereabouts of Lim or the Watercolour is asked to call the U.S. Coast Guard at 510-437-3701.
